Look at these six key features:

1. Being Candid

Yes, not many people in the world of business have this quality. But what does it involve? A person with this condition is straightforward. He or she will not waste your time as if you are watching a documentary or reading a novel.

The person gets straight to the main point. In other words, the person speaks the truth right into the eye. No lies are told to agents, clients or staff.

2. Focus

Virtually everything one does need maximum attention. Even if you were talking to a person, driving your car or operating a machine, to focus is crucial. The same is needed for bookies. Running a successful pay per head business requires this quality. Otherwise, your business will collapse.

3. Integrity

Integrity is a big quality. To say that a person has integrity, he or she must have quality number 1 above. Alternatively, a person is said to have integrity when he is known to be free from any blame. No corruption, no lies, no silly utterances and many more vices that are seen everywhere today. A person with integrity will not be happy when a client uses all his/her money on his site while the customer’s family is living in abject poverty.

4. Emotional Intelligence

This is more or less putting you in other peoples’ problems. Ask yourself, if I were in his position right now, what would I expect? How would I want him to handle my situation? A person full of emotional intelligence knows that at some time, a client can be mad maybe because his/her projections failed, the system jammed or for some other reason. No need to argue.

5. Client-Centric Attitude

Bookie business is purely service industry. If a bookie doesn’t care how a client feels or what the customer gets, the business will be doomed to fail. A good bookie will ensure that a client gets the best, is treated with high-esteem knowing that were it not for the customer the business would be no more.

6. Burning Passion

Yes, without a burning passion for bookmarking, how do you think you’ll make it in an industry that is growing super-fast? There are chances you will back-off. It is an important thing that when you enter into bookie business, you do it because you love running and owning a cheap pay per head bookie business. There could be more, but the six are a must-have.
